Key Responsibilities

  • •Control, test, and calibrate MOD test equipment in line with MOD Air publications and approved Manual of Military Air systems.
  • •Maintain and service altimeters, including accurate records and compliance with airworthiness requirements.
  • •Deliver Precision Termination Tooling (PTT) and Electrical Wiring Interconnect Systems (EWIS) training and presentations.
  • •Provide expert support for EWIS training, offering clear guidance to customers and colleagues.
  • •Ensure work is correctly certified, recorded, and retained to meet statutory, quality, and audit requirements.

Key Requirements

  • •Have an engineering or aviation qualification such as BTEC, ONC, NVQ Level 3, or a military equivalent.
  • •Relevant aviation industry experience with a strong understanding of air safety and airworthiness.
  • •Stay current and competent in risk management, human factors, and error management.
  • •Confidently use Microsoft Office, including Excel and Word.
  • •Strong written and verbal communication skills to deliver training and technical briefings.
